Repair Request Guide for Minnesota Realtors

A strong repair request identifies specific documented defects, prioritizes safety and major items, and asks for clear remedies — repair by a licensed trade, a credit, or a price reduction. Vague or cosmetic-heavy requests weaken your client's position.

What to request

Focus on safety hazards and expensive systems at end of life. For electrical or structural items, request work by a licensed trade with documentation, not a handyman patch.

How to document

Attach the inspection report's relevant photos and finding language so everyone is negotiating from the same documented condition.

Setting expectations

Most sellers expect some request. A reasonable, prioritized list is far more likely to be honored than an exhaustive one.
